emax =±q/2≈±2mV。
在A/D转换器的输出位数n足够多时,可以使量化误差 达到足够小,就可以认为数字信号近似于采样信号。如果在 采样过程中,采样频率也足够高,就可以用采样、量化 后得到的一系列离散的二进制数字量来表示某一时间上连续 的模拟信号,从而可以由计算机来进行控制计算和处理。
模拟量输入通道的组成
AL,04H DX,AL
;使CE=1,启动转换
+ -
R3
CS R /C
AGND A0 DGND
NOP NOP MOV AL,03H ; 使CE=0, CS =1 OUT DX,AL R1 POLLING: IN AL,DX ; 查询STS状态 TEST AL,80H 模拟输入 JNZ POLLING ;STS=1,则等待 MOV AL,01H ; 使CE=0 , R/C=1 OUT DX,AL R2 NOP MOV OUT MOV IN AND MOV INC AL,05H DX,AL DX,02C0H AL,DX AL,0FH BH,AL DX ;使CE=1,允许读出 ;读A口 ;将DB11 ~DB8存入BH中 ;读B口
DO00~DO11 ——12位数据输出,均带三态输出锁存缓冲器 10VIN ——模拟信号输入端,单极性0~10V, 双极性±5V 20VIN——模拟信号输入端,单极性0~20V, 双极性±10V BIPOFF ——双极性偏置端。0V时,输入单极性模拟信号; 10V,输入双极性模拟信号。 REFIN ——参考输入 REFOUT——参考输出端 VLOGIC ——逻辑电源+5V(4.5~5.5V)。 VCC——正电源+15V(13.5~16.5V)。 VEE ——负电源-15V(-13.5~-16.5V)。 AGND —— 模拟地 DGND —— 数字地 CS ——片选信号,低电平有效。 CE和CS必须同时有效,AD574A CE——片使能信号,高电平有效. 才能工作,否则处于禁止状态 R/C ——读出和转换控制信号,当0 时,启动A/D转换;